Michael D. McDonald

August 22, 1950 ~ May 2, 2023

Michael D. McDonald (Rabbit), age 72, longtime resident of Caledonia, MI and Phoenix, AZ, passed away on Tuesday, May 2, 2023, after an extended illness. Mike graduated from Caledonia High School in 1969. He was a proud 10-year veteran of the United States Coast Guard, and a staunch University of Michigan Wolverine fan. He was preceded in death by his parents, Bob and Carleen, and brothers, Rob and David. He will be lovingly remembered by his siblings, Annie (Danny), Melanie (Dan), Jenni (Joe) and Dan (Darren), close lifelong friends Mark, Jamie, Faye, John, Randy, and Karen, and many nieces, nephews and cousins. He will be greatly missed by his extended family Lori, Dylan, TJ, Navaya, Sarah and Mark. Mike, or “Rabbit” as he was known to his closest family and friends, will always be remembered for his kind heart and his silly sense of humor. One of his favorite jokes was “A horse walks into a bar; the bartender says ‘Hey, why the long face?’” Family and friends will receive visitors on Friday morning, May 12, 2023 from 10-11 a.m. at Holy Family Church, 9669 Kraft Ave. SE, Caledonia. A memorial mass and luncheon will follow. Burial will be held at Resurrection Cemetery at 2:15 p.m. A celebration of Mike’s life will be held on Sunday, July 9 at Caledonia Lakeside Park. In lieu of flowers, as Mike was a huge advocate for rescue animals, we ask that you give a donation in his name to his favorite rescue organization, Ellijay Paws In Need or to an animal rescue or charity that is close to your heart.
